Devotional Exhortation
Jesus doesn’t simply give life—He IS Life. Everything you're seeking—peace, purpose, breakthrough—is wrapped in a relationship with Him. Without Him, it’s like drawing water with broken buckets (Haggai 1:6). With Him, “rivers of living water” will flow from your heart (John 7:38).
Bible Anchors & Stories of Resurrection
- The Woman with the Issue of Blood (Mark 5:25–34)
She tried everything—until she touched Jesus. One touch brought healing and hope.
- The Valley of Dry Bones (Ezekiel 37:1–14)
A lifeless graveyard became a mighty army. God can breathe life into your “dead” seasons.
- Lazarus Raised from the Dead (John 11)
Even when it seems too late, God’s timing is perfect. Jesus brings what’s buried back to life.
